Ingredients for spanish broad beans and chorizo
For this broad beans recipe (receta de habas), you’ll need:
-
250g (2 cups) shelled fresh broad beans or baby broad beans
-
50ml (3½ tbsp) extra virgin olive oil
-
1 onion, finely chopped
-
5 garlic cloves (perfect for garlic broad beans flavor)
-
1 sprig fresh oregano
-
90g Spanish chorizo (fresh uncooked)
-
Zest and juice of 1 lemon
-
Sea salt and freshly ground black pepper
-
Crusty bread for serving

How to cook fresh broad beans with chorizo
Follow this step-by-step guide to create the perfect Spanish beans with chorizo:
Prepare the Broad Beans
-
Bring salted water to boil
-
Cook broad beans for 2 minutes (this is how long to boil broad beans)
-
Drain and rinse under cold water
-
Shell broad beans if using fresh broad beans
Create the chorizo base
-
Heat olive oil in a pan
-
Add onion, garlic, oregano, and chorizo
-
Cook until onions are transparent
Complete the Stew
-
Add shelled broad beans
-
Sauté for 2 minutes
-
Add water and seasonings
-
Finish with lemon
Professional tips for cooking broad beans
-
When learning how to cook fresh broad beans, always remove the outer shell for tender results
-
For the best broad bean stew, use fresh chorizo rather than cured
-
This beans with chorizo recipe works with both fresh and frozen broad beans
-
Store leftover broad beans and chorizo stew in an airtight container
Tips for storing and preparing
-
Store fresh broad beans in the refrigerator
-
Shell broad beans just before cooking
-
Leftover stew keeps well for 2-3 days
